NEW YORK, May 17, 2017 -- Intercept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(Nasdaq:ICPT), a biopharmaceutical company focused on the development and commercialization of novel therapeutics to treat progressive non-viral liver diseases, today announced management will be participating in the following investor conferences:
- UBS Global Healthcare Conference on May 23, 2017 at 2:30 p.m. Eastern Time
- Jefferies Healthcare Conference on June 8, 2017 at 2:00 p.m. Eastern Time
- Goldman Sachs 38th Annual Healthcare Conference on June 13, 2017 at 11:20 a.m. Pacific Time
Webcast information for these events will be available on the Investors page of Intercept's website at http://ir.interceptpharma.com. Archived webcasts will be available on Intercept's website for approximately two weeks.
About Intercept
Intercept is a biopharmaceutical company focused on the development and commercialization of novel therapeutics to treat progressive non-viral liver diseases, including primary biliary cholangitis (PBC), nonalc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), primary sclerosing cholangitis (PSC) and biliary atresia. Founded in 2002 in New York, Intercept now has operations in the United States, Europe and Canada.
